MISO-J1934 is a proposed 150 MW battery storage project located in Kenosha County, Wisconsin. The project, which interconnects to the American Transmission Company via the Lakeview 138kV point of interconnection, entered the MISO interconnection queue on August 24, 2021. Its proposed commercial operation date is October 1, 2025. The project's interconnection status is currently in the Cluster Study phase.
The development project consists solely of battery storage, with a total capacity of 150 MW. The project is listed in the MISO interconnection queue.
